The Child and the Institution : : A Study of Deprivation and Recovery / / Betty Flint.
It has long been believed that children who must spend much of their lives in institutions inevitably develop personality deficiencies that make them liabilities to society. This book represents the first portion of a longitudinal study of the children of the Neil McNeil Home from infancy into adult...
